Short Interest in Tivic Health Systems, Inc. (NASDAQ:TIVC) Declines By 23.6%

Tivic Health Systems, Inc. (NASDAQ:TIVCGet Free Report) saw a significant decrease in short interest in the month of September. As of September 30th, there was short interest totalling 62,200 shares, a decrease of 23.6% from the September 15th total of 81,400 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 4,950,000 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 0.0 days. Approximately 1.0% of the company’s stock are sold short.

Tivic Health Systems Stock Performance

Shares of NASDAQ TIVC remained flat at $0.23 on Tuesday. 188,022 shares of the company’s st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 1,880,327. The company has a 50 day moving average of $0.30 and a 200 day moving average of $0.53. Tivic Health Systems has a fifty-two week low of $0.22 and a fifty-two week high of $3.21.

Tivic Health Systems (NASDAQ:TIVCG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, August 14th. The company reported ($0.32) EPS for the quarter. Tivic Health Systems had a negative return on equity of 172.08% and a negative net margin of 606.47%. The company had revenue of $0.14 million during the quarter.

Tivic Health Systems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Tivic Health Systems Inc operates as a health tech company, focuses on developing and commercializing bioelectronic medicine. Its primary product is ClearUP, a bioelectronic medicine for the treatment of sinus and nasal inflammation.
